Perils Of Going Parallel

“As multicore becomes commonplace, IT organizations are faced with the task of getting the most bang from their buck. Particularly for applications developed in-house, the decision to reprogram for parallel execution goes well beyond using some new programming techniques. Going parallel requires revising tried-and-true processes and rethinking how project teams are built.

For those involved in staffing and assembling project teams, managing multicore development may involve finding and allocating people with thread programming expertise, and they’re hard to find. Along with that, deploying highly threaded applications introduces systems concerns. All of these problems can be handled, but because the solutions may require crossing departmental lines, they’ll likely require high-level management involvement. ”
